Warzone may be winding down given the imminent arrival of its successor, Warzone 2, but players are still eager to know the weapons they should be rocking in Caldera\u2019s closing weeks. While guns like the Armaguerra 43 and Cooper Carbine are the most used (and therefore the most \u2018meta\u2019) in Season 5 Reloaded, some weapons can fly under the radar while being just as viable. One, according to Warzone statistician and expert JGOD, is the Black Ops Cold War EM2, a slow firing AR that was added to Treyarch\u2019s title with Season 5 of the previous annual cycle. JGOD\u2019s EM2 Warzone loadout for Season 5 Reloaded Despite being largely ignored in Vanguard\u2019s cycle \u2013 sitting at a 0.19% pick rate according to WZRanked \u2013 it can shred enemies at longer ranges and is perfect to dominate Caldera\u2019s closing days. Stating it\u2019s perfect for long ranges, he said: \u201cThat brings us to a little bit more of a higher skill weapon, which is the EM2. It\u2019s always been nasty, it used to be significantly more broken but this is where it\u2019s landed because of the change to health.\u201d His full class loadout is below, maximizing its range and damage at the expense of speed and handling. This shouldn\u2019t matter too much though, as players should mainly be relying on the EM2 at longer ranges. Muzzle: Agency Suppressor &#8211; Barrel: 25.8\u201d Task Force &#8211; Optic: Axial Arms 3x &#8211; Underbarrel: Field Agent Grip &#8211; Magazine: 40 Round Mag &#8211; As previously stated, players should only trust the EM2 at longer ranges. Its slow fire rate means it will usually be outgunned at close range but, for enemies further away, there are few weapons that can shred armor and health as quickly. It does bounce around slightly but some time with the weapon will ensure players can maintain accuracy, even when aiming for opponents at considerable distances.
